The level of confidence an athlete has influences his ability to perform under pressure and in difficult situations. Surprisingly, an athlete’s level of confidence is influenced by his or her performance. A high-performing athlete is always confident, which helps him perform better. Athletes who lack confidence as a result of poor performance in the past, on the other hand, make more mistakes.
In any case, confidence is an important aspect of athletics. When they are underperforming, successful athletes usually find ways to boost their self-esteem. They are not hampered by a lack of performance or current form, but rather seek solutions to the problems that arise as a result of their lack of confidence. It is critical to ask oneself questions in these situations. Finding answers to these questions and incorporating them into your game is what takes a regular player from a regular player to a special player.
